Since I bought the 2010 Canyon Star I was interested to see what changes might be in the offing for 2011. New front cap, exterior graphics, dash layout and elimination of some floor plans (including mine) are all I can see. I note they don't offer a king bed option which is what sold us on our coach.

All in all, not much change for 2011 but then my 2010 was basically identical to the 2009 version.

We chose the std. Beech too, very happy with them. Last year, the only option was the Fall Spice which was just a shade or two darker than the Beech and wasn't much of a choice. At least this year the Maple option presents a choice of a darker finish which personally I like but not in a Motorhome where, while rich looking, tends to darken the interior too much for our tastes.
